Customs brokerage is essential in facilitating the movement of goods across borders, and a customs broker's expertise is invaluable in ensuring compliance and minimizing delays and costs. Importers should prioritize obtaining a customs bond from a reliable provider to guarantee compliance with customs regulations and avoid penalties or shipment delays. Importer Security Filing (ISF) is a mandatory requirement for importers shipping goods to the United States, and accurate and timely filing is crucial to avoid penalties and cargo release delays. Importers should start the filing process early, collect required information efficiently, and utilize robust customs brokerage software for streamlined ISF filing. Accurate and up-to-date record-keeping is another vital best practice for importers as it helps in retrieving information when needed and resolving discrepancies promptly. Compliance and efficiency are key in international trade, and by following these best practices, importers can ensure a smooth and successful customs clearance process.
